picture of Liam Osolin
null

75 lbs 3rd Place Match - Liam Oliver, The Storm Wrestling Center vs Liam Osolin, C2X

Dec 28, 2024

75 lbs 3rd Place Match - Liam Oliver, The Storm Wrestling Center vs Liam Osolin, C2X